Calcined bauxite is a key raw material in refractory production. After high-temperature calcination (1100°C to 1600°C), Al₂O₃ content increases from 57%-58% in raw bauxite to 70%-88%. This makes it the structural backbone of refractory castables, firebricks, and other high-temperature materials.
How Al₂O₃ Content Affects Performance
Al₂O₃ content is the key factor that determines refractory performance. Higher Al₂O₃ means higher refractoriness, higher density, and better thermal stability. Al₂O₃ content is important, but two other factors also matter.
1. Impurities
Fe₂O₃ and TiO₂ affect material performance. High Fe₂O₃ can lower refractoriness, while high TiO₂ affects purity. SEPPE controls Fe₂O₃ ≤ 2.0% and TiO₂ ≤ 4.0% to ensure stable quality.

Using unsuitable calcined bauxite can cause problems:
1. High impurities——lower refractoriness, risk of softening at high temperatures
2. Poorly sintered clinker——continued shrinkage, leading to cracks
3. High water absorption——increased cracking risk
4. Poor particle size distribution——low density, weak strength
These issues waste material and can shorten furnace life.
